I just got through the most annoying customer service chat in my life, and since I'm somewhat wroth over the whole thing, I feel like sharing. Basically, my problems began when I tried to join a server. I got disconnected without any error code. I tried again, and the same deal. The game doesn't even launch, and I simply get a message in my Firefox browser saying that I have been disconnected. Fair enough, sometimes this happens, so I try again a dozen times over. Nothing. The same damn error message "Game got disconnected()" pops up every bleeding time.
So, I click on the little "Feedback&Support" link on the left-hand side of the browser. I get connected to a guy in India. Hey, I live in Europe, so most of the tech support gets rerouted to there. No problem.
I talk to the guy for a while, and he gives me detailed troubleshooting instructions on how to make Battlefield 3/Origin run better.
1. shutdown all software and hardware firewalls
2. end every other process other than Explorer and TaskMgr
3. clean up my Temp folder (I run Uniblue PowerSuite 2011's programs every week, so this is hardly a big deal)
4. run Origin with full Admin privileges
When I refused to perform these steps the guy said that none of this will harm my computer in any way. He was adamant on this point - using CAPS and all. At this point I feel like uninstalling Origin and BF3, and just forgetting this whole mess ever took place. I had some old games that I took to GameStop in exchange for getting BF3, so I only really paid 7 euros for this game. Still that's valuable trades lost right there. I'm not going to get my money back, but I did receive a 20% discount coupon for my next Origin purchase. It's good for a month, but somehow I doubt, I'll have any use for the damn thing.
